Finding the Wonder: Why Cabinets of Curiosities Are Captivating Collectors Again
There was a time when enthusiasts didn't just acquire to have-- they curated their collections as stories. Lengthy prior to minimal insides and electronic galleries, the "closet of interests" was the best expression of curiosity, taste, and intellect. Also referred to as wunderkammern, these cupboards were less regarding storage and more regarding spectacle-- ornate screens full of unusual minerals, maintained insects, tribal artifacts, scientific wonders, and imaginative prizes. They were a declaration of understanding and wonder.
Fast-forward to today, and something fascinating is happening. The cabinet of curiosities is making a silent yet striking return. In an age saturated with digital web content, there's an expanding hunger for the tangible, the distinct, and the storied. Modern collectors are reviving the spirit of these cupboards-- not just in the actual feeling but in how they come close to accumulating: with consideration, intentionality, and an enthusiasm for the uncommon.

Blending the Past and Present: How Old Meets New in Collecting
Among the most amazing facets of this revival is exactly how it combines the vintage with the new. Where standard closets were filled with natural wonders and exotic quirks, contemporary analyses typically mix historical artefacts with contemporary pieces. You may discover a 19th-century dispenser container alongside a modern abstract sculpture. Or an old coin presented close to a classic camera.
This blend offers a split sense of time. It creates contrast and depth-- something contemporary interiors commonly do not have. It also reflects the collection agency's trip, their inquisitiveness extending across eras and designs. Interest on Display: Creating Modern Cabinets at Home
The cabinet of inquisitiveness isn't almost what you gather-- it's about just how you show it. While the original closets were commonly literal wood cupboards or rooms, modern-day analyses take lots of forms: wall surface shelves loaded with strangeness, shadow boxes with clinical pictures, and drifting situations with antiques organized by shade or material.
What continues to be constant is the need to intrigue. Whether displayed in a corridor niche or throughout a mantelpiece, these things draw you in. They urge closer inspection, stimulate questions, and spark tales. This is what makes the cabinet of interests such an effective design and gathering ideology: it transforms your area right into a living gallery of your interests, values, and experiences.
